Paychex Q4 2020 Earnings Report

Paychex's fourth quarter and fiscal year 2020 results were released, showing a decrease in revenue and earnings per share for the quarter due to the impact of COVID-19.

Key Takeaways

Paychex reported a 7% decrease in total revenue for the fourth quarter to $915.1 million, with net income decreasing by 4% to $220.7 million and diluted earnings per share decreasing by 5% to $0.61. The results were impacted by the COVID-19 pandemic, which caused business shutdowns and affected sales and financial performance.

Total revenue decreased 7% to $915.1 million.

Net income decreased 4% to $220.7 million.

Diluted earnings per share decreased 5% to $0.61 per share.

COVID-19 pandemic adversely impacted results due to business suspensions.
